Inclusion Criteria

Patient consent to enter the study
Age range from 30 to 70 years
Patients who, according to the latest guidelines of the Ministry of Health and Medicine, have been diagnosed with high blood pressure or had uncontrolled blood pressure (blood pressure = 90.140 mmHg) despite taking medication.

Exclusion Criteria

Severe physical or mental illness
addiction
pregnancy

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Sleep quality. Timepoint: before, one month and three months after the end of the intervention. Method of measurement: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index (PSQI).;Blood pressure. Timepoint: before, one month and three months after the end of the intervention. Method of measurement: With the help of a mercury pressure gauge.
